Later in the game, Malo opens a store in [[Kakariko Village]] to replace the general store and names the new store [[Malo Mart]]. After establishing himself in the business world, he aspires to take control of the over-priced [[Chudley's Shop|shop]] in [[Castle Town]]. To do so, he must first enlist the help of [[Link]] to raise funds required to repair the bridge that connects Castle Town and Kakariko Village in the most convenient way. Then, he asks for even more money to buy-out the shop that was already established there.

Malo's prices are ''much better'' than the prices that the shop originally had. Often dropping hundreds of [[Rupee]]s off of the original price, allowing Link to get the [[Magic Armor]] for the price of 598 Rupees, where as the previous shop sold it for 100,000 Rupees.
